Believe it or not, the plant kingdom offers a treasure trove of textures and tastes that can rival your favourite carnivorous dishes. From jackfruit, with its fibrous consistency, perfect for replicating shredded chicken; tempeh, with its firm and nutty flavour; to meaty mushrooms, such as portobello and shiitake, that offer a rich umami flavour and dense bite, we explore five varieties of meat alternatives that masterfully mimic the texture and taste of meat.
